Released , 'Aku Tak Bodoh' stars Riezman Khuzaimi, Amy Mastura, Namron, Adibah Noor The mov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 37 min, and received a user score of 52 (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from 2 respected users.

What, so now you want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"A Malay remake of Jack Neos 2002 hit I Not Stupid Too directed by Boris Boo A 16yearold boy named Roy who is stuck with a dysfunctional family Both of his parents are two busy working adults who in pursuit of luxury with the thinking that fiscal and material things are the only necessities their children would ever need had neglected the emotional needs of Roy and his younger brother Jefri in the process Follow Roys misadventures as he copes with preadolescence depression and even joining a small group of gangsters as means of fulfilling the void left by his problematic home situation and finding his true self" .
